Wael Hadi is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Information Systems and Computational Theory and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Wael Hadi has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 358 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 11 papers in Information Systems and 5 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ics. Recurrent topics in Wael Hadi’s work include Text and Document Classification Technologies (12 papers),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(8 papers) and Rough Sets and Fuzzy Logic (5 papers). Wael Hadi is often cited by papers focused on Text and Document Classification Technologies (12 papers),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(8 papers) and Rough Sets and Fuzzy Logic (5 papers). Wael Hadi collaborates with scholars based in Jordan, United Kingdom and Indonesia. Wael Hadi's co-authors include Samer Alhawari, Faisal Aburub, Fadi Thabtah, Neda Abdelhamid, Qasem A. Al‐Radaideh, Ghassan F. Issa, Aladdin Ayesh, Hussein Abdel-Jaber, Samad Ahmadi and Omar Almomani and has published in prestigious journals such as Information Sciences, Applied Soft Computing and Computers in Biology and Medicine.
